Abstract :
We examine here the oscillation of electron-beam density perturbations (longitudinal plasma oscillations) produced at the exit of a high-gain free-electron laser (FEL) by the action of the FEL instability. These oscillations, which are analyzed in the case of both a free-space drift and a dispersive section, can degrade the bunching of the beam in the drift between undulator sections in multi-stage FELs. The impact of these oscillations on the gain of an FEL in an undulator following such a drift, as well as the case of an optical klystron is studied.
